Your hand begins to glow green, and a otherworldly power fills your being as you swing a punch into the maw of an enemy with ethereal force. Make a melee spell attack. On a hit, it deals 4d8 bludgeoning damage. To undead, it deals 6d8. To vampires, it deals 9d8 and the vampire has to make a CON saving throw against your spellsave DC + 3. On a successful save, nothing happens. On a failed save, the vampire has to make a Constitution saving throw at the end of every turn. If it fails, it cannot regenerate next turn. If it succeeds, the effect ends.
* - (A Holy Symbol, A Clove of Garlic worth 10gp that is consumed upon casting. )
